在数字化时代,数据存储与处理的需求日益增长,许多企业和个人都在寻找高效、稳定且成本可控的解决方案,在构建IT基础设施时,一个常见的误区是过度依赖服务器设备,将其视为唯一的解决方案,不引入传统服务器也能实现高效的数据管理和业务运行,这种模式不仅降低了初期投入成本,还能简化运维流程,提升系统的灵活性和可扩展性。

为什么可以不引入服务器
传统服务器通常需要专门的硬件设备、稳定的运行环境以及专业的维护团队,这对于中小企业或初创项目而言是一笔不小的开销,随着云计算和分布式技术的发展,虚拟化、容器化以及无服务器架构逐渐成熟,这些技术允许用户在不直接管理物理服务器的情况下,部署和运行应用程序,云服务提供商提供了按需分配的计算资源,用户只需根据实际使用量付费,无需购买和维护昂贵的服务器设备,无服务器架构将底层基础设施的管理责任转移给云服务商,开发者可以专注于业务逻辑的实现,从而大幅提升开发效率。
替代方案的核心优势
不引入服务器并不意味着放弃高性能的计算能力,而是通过更先进的技术手段实现资源的优化配置,成本效益显著,传统服务器的采购、电力、冷却和维护成本较高,而基于云的解决方案采用订阅制模式,用户可以根据业务需求灵活调整资源使用量,避免资源浪费,可扩展性强,云平台支持自动扩容和缩容,当业务量激增时,系统可以快速增加计算资源;反之,则减少资源占用,确保资源的高效利用,可靠性更高,云服务商通常在全球范围内部署多个数据中心,具备容灾备份能力,即使某个节点出现故障,系统也能自动切换到其他节点,保证业务的连续性。
如何选择合适的替代方案
在不引入服务器的情况下,企业需要根据自身需求选择合适的技术路径,对于需要快速部署和迭代的互联网应用,容器化技术(如Docker和Kubernetes)是一个理想选择,容器将应用程序及其依赖环境打包成独立的单元,确保在不同环境中的一致性运行,同时支持微服务架构,便于系统的模块化开发和管理,对于需要处理大规模数据的场景,分布式存储和计算框架(如Hadoop和Spark)能够替代传统服务器的存储和计算功能,通过多台普通计算机的协同工作,实现高性能的数据处理,Serverless(无服务器)架构适用于事件驱动的应用场景,如文件处理、API网关和实时数据处理,用户只需编写函数代码,无需关心服务器的运行状态。

实施过程中的注意事项
虽然不引入服务器具有诸多优势,但在实际实施过程中仍需注意一些关键问题,数据安全与隐私保护是不可忽视的一环,选择信誉良好的云服务商,确保其符合行业安全标准,并采用加密技术保护数据传输和存储过程中的安全性,网络依赖性较高,基于云的解决方案依赖于稳定的网络连接,如果网络出现波动,可能会影响系统的响应速度和可用性,企业需要评估自身的网络基础设施,必要时采用多线路接入或混合云架构来降低风险,技术团队的转型也是重要挑战,传统IT团队需要学习新的技术栈和运维理念,企业应加强培训,引入具备云原生技术经验的人才,确保顺利过渡。
未来发展趋势
随着技术的不断进步,不引入服务器的模式将进一步普及,边缘计算的兴起将计算能力下沉到靠近用户的边缘节点,减少对中心化云服务的依赖,提升实时性要求高的应用性能(如物联网和自动驾驶),人工智能与云原生的结合将推动更智能的资源调度和管理,例如通过机器学习算法预测业务负载,自动调整资源配置,绿色计算也成为行业关注的焦点,云服务商通过优化数据中心能源使用,降低碳排放,推动可持续发展。
相关问答FAQs
问题1:不引入服务器是否意味着完全不需要硬件设备?
解答:不引入服务器并非完全不需要硬件设备,而是将硬件管理责任转移给云服务商或采用分布式硬件架构,使用云服务时,用户无需直接购买服务器,但云服务商的数据中心仍依赖物理硬件;而采用边缘计算时,可能需要在本地部署边缘设备,但这些设备通常比传统服务器更轻量、更灵活。

问题2:不引入服务器适合所有类型的企业吗?
解答:并非所有企业都适合不引入服务器的模式,对于需要高度定制化硬件、严格数据主权控制或网络连接极不稳定的场景,传统服务器可能仍是更合适的选择,企业应结合自身业务特点、预算和技术能力,评估是否采用无服务器或云原生方案,必要时采用混合云架构平衡需求。